While many of us have been conditioned to expect a regular bonus from work or some other gift of money, either from living relatives or through an estate, there is still a big thrill when circumstances drop a big pile of money into your life. What would you do with yours?
Let’s examine your choices for your windfall.
Thinking About the Future
• Review Your Accounts — Reviewing your contributions to your personal or workplace retirement accounts is one way to prepare for the future.
• Invest — Perhaps it might be time to consider some sort of investment. We can discuss your options.
• Emergency Fund — If you don’t have one, now’s a great time to start it. If you do have one, it might be time to review.
Debt
It casts a long shadow, so it’s always nice to get a bit of sunshine instead.
• Consider Paying it Down or Off — Using your windfall to pay off any high-interest debts.
Family
If you’re raising kids, you know some things are coming up, either college or something else.
• College Plans — If saving for your child’s college education is a top priority, you may want to use part of the windfall.
• Saving and Investing — Remember that the future for your loved ones goes well beyond immediate concerns.
Saving for Big Purchases
You might have a big purchase in mind. We can discuss any of them, whether they are listed here or not.
• Down Payment on a Home — Many people’s goals include home ownership. If you want to buy a home or are already well on that path, your bonus could get you on that goal.
• Vacation — You know you have one in mind! It’s the vacation to end all vacations, whether it requires a giant jet or a private yacht. Talk to me about how we can start a place to set aside money for this goal.
